### Account Recovery — Catalogue Import (Lintwood)

Quick one for review: when the Lintwood catalogue import wipes a patron's session table, the recovery flow re-seeds accounts from the nightly snapshot. Check that the importer skips locked accounts — last time it didn't. To rerun recovery against staging you'll need the vault passphrase, which is appended just below.

recovery phrase for yafof-tajof: julmir-kelax-julvan-holath-belvan-holir-ralael-ralvan-ralath-julvan-silmir-istmir-kaswyn-ulamir

// Fixture for DiffHaven's large-file diff viewer plugin API.
// Chunks over 8 MB are streamed; your plugin receives windows,
// never the full buffer. Do not assume line offsets are stable
// across windows — recompute per chunk. This fixture simulates a
// 2 GB log diff with three hunks and one binary segment that
// must be skipped. The mock Hunkserve endpoint checks auth on
// every window request. Tests authenticate with the bearer
// token on the next line.

session JWT of yawep-yawep = eyJhbGciOiJIUzI1NiIsInR5cCI6IkpXVCJ9.eyJzdWIiOiI3pWF3_In0.aXYsHiog

Meeting Notes — Excerpt

Item 4: Drone servicing. The survey drone from the Northquay site was returned Monday with a faulty gimbal. Tamsin logged it and packed it in the padded case. Fennick Aerotech will service it; their courier collects Friday. Office manager to witness the exchange, which must follow the hand-over instruction below.

courier memo of fajeg-yagag: the pramir keleth courier leaves the wenax holox ralix ledger at gate 8171 under passcode 428648

## Changelog — Fareline Rules Engine 2.1

Default evaluation mode for shipping-fee rules changed from permissive to strict: unmatched shipments now reject rather than falling through to zero-fee. Rule uploads are validated and signed before activation, closing the prior unsigned-override path. For audit purposes, the shipped default configuration is reproduced in full below.

settings of tagef-bawif:
DRUIX_HOST=druix.zemvarlabs.internal
DRUIX_PORT=8000